How Our Water Damage Restoration Process Works

When you call us for help, our team springs into action. We’ll arrive at your rental property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and develop a customized restoration plan. From there, our certified technicians will work tirelessly to:

Step 1: Water Extraction

Our team will use state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your rental property.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th. Within 60 minutes, we’ll have removed up to 2 inches of standing water, and you’ll be on your way to recovery.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, our crew will use specialized drying equipment to speed up the evaporation process. We’ll also deploy d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air, ensuring your rental property is dry and safe. This process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

After the drying process is complete, our team will use specialized equipment to sanitize and disinfect your rental property. This ensures that any remaining bacteria, viruses, or mold spores are eliminated, leaving your property safe and healthy for tenants.

Step 4: Reconstruction and Repair

Our final step is to repair and rebuild any damaged areas of your rental property. This may include fixing drywall, installing new flooring, or replacing damaged roofs.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ring subtle warning signs can lead to catastrophic consequences. Keep an eye out for these common indicators: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ant, lingering odors can be a sign of hidden moisture issues. Don’t ignore this warning sign, mold and mildew can spread quickly, causing costly damage and health risks. Our team will identify the source of the odor and restore your rental property to a safe, healthy environment.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Visible water stains can be a clear indication of a larger issue. Don’t wait until the damage is extensive, our team will assess the situation and create a customized restoration plan to fix the problem before it becomes a major headache.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Uneven flooring can be a sign of water damage, and it’s not just aesthetically unpleasing, it can also lead to serious safety hazards. Our team will assess the situation and recommend the best course of action to get your rental property back in shape.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Flaking paint or peeling wallpaper can be a sign of moisture issues lurking beneath the surface. Our team will identify the root cause of the problem and provide a comprehensive solution to prevent further damage.

Increased Humidity or Condensation

Unusual humidity levels or condensation can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t ignore this warning sign, our team will assess the situation and create a customized plan to restore your rental property to a safe, healthy environment.

Discolored or Fading Materials

Visible discoloration or fading can be a sign of water damage or prolonged exposure to moisture. Our team will assess the situation and recommend the best course of action to restore your rental property to its original condition.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in Rathdrum, ID

The cost of water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Rathdrum, ID. These estimates are based on our experience working with rental property owners in the area: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Equipment rental, labor costs
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Equipment rental, labor costs
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Materials, labor costs, complexity of repairs
